How the answer is worked out

One kilobyte is 8,000 bits, so converting is a single multiplication:

200 kB × 8,000 = 1,600,000 b

Frequently asked questions

How many bits is 200 kilobytes?
200 kilobytes is 1,600,000 bits. The conversion multiplies by 8,000, so 200 × 8,000 = 1,600,000.
What is the formula to convert kilobytes to bits?
bits = kilobytes × 8,000. One kilobyte is 8,000 bits.
How do I convert 200 bits back to kilobytes?
Use the reverse conversion: 200 bits is 0.025 kilobytes.
Is this conversion exact?
The underlying factor is exact as defined by the SI and the 1959 international agreements. The figure shown is rounded to seven significant digits for readability.
